Release checklist — Tollbridge report exports. Confirm exported timestamps render in the subscriber's configured timezone, not server UTC, including DST boundary dates. Run the Midwinter fixture set and diff against golden files. If any offset mismatch appears, block the release and page the reports team. Record the candidate build token below.

pipeline stamp: htk31_f769b577b3028a4e9958e5bb8d1259a

## Approvals: ChipGate Reader

Future maintainers, welcome. The ChipGate timing-chip reader at the Harrowvale Marathon has a strict approvals flow because a bad firmware push once scrambled split times mid-race. Any firmware change, antenna tuning, or mat-layout edit needs two approvals: one from the race-ops lead and one from engineering. Config tweaks during race week are frozen entirely unless both sign off in the Startline tracker. Don't skip this, even for "tiny" fixes. Final approval authority rests with the person named below.

approver of kafog-yageg = Briwyn Sorwyn Gilmir

## Deployment

The Vigilarch proctoring queue deploys as a single worker pool behind the Hallmere scheduler. Future maintainers should deploy queue workers before the intake gateway, otherwise sessions enqueue against a stale topology. Run the preflight script, confirm the drain completes, then roll workers one zone at a time. The deployment reads the configuration values listed directly below.

service settings:
PRAIX_LOG_LEVEL=error
PRAIX_METRICS_HOST=metrics.praix.qorvelcorp.corp
PRAIX_POOL_SIZE=16

**Q: The Shelfwise catalogue import stalls halfway — what gives?** A: Usually the importer hit a locked MARC batch from the old Pellbrook system and paused rather than skipping records. Don't restart the job; that duplicates entries. Instead, unlock the batch archive and let it resume on its own. To unlock, you'll need the archive's recovery passphrase, which is:

unlock words, fahog-yahof: belael-holael-eliius-joreth-tamax-olimir-norwyn-holwyn-fraath-lamius-norwyn-druys-soriel